The pathogenesis of osteopontin in rheumatoid arthritis / 中华风湿病学杂志

ABSTRACT
Objective To study regulatory mechanism of osteopontin (OPN) in rheumatoid arthritis (RA). Methods The expression of OPN in peripheral blood mononuclear cells (PBMC), synovial fluid cells (SFMC) and synovium tissue (ST) and T cell subsets from RA patients were detected by real time PCR. The concentration and relative rate of inflammatory factors in the synovial fluid from RA patients were analyzed by ELISA. Results The mRNA expression of OPN in synovial fluid and tissue was higher than that of PBMC in the same RA patient. The OPN expression was found mainly on CD4+T. The OPN concentration was higher in the synovial fluid than that of in the same patient′s serum. Meanwhile, the concentration of IL-10, IFN-? and TNF-? was higher than that of in the serum from same patient. Also, the concentration of IL-18 and IL-12 were higher than that of normal individual serum. Conclusion OPN may control secretion of inflammatory factors of synovium tissue and synovial fluid and induce the inflammatory response.
